Current time in Lovech, Bulgaria
Local clocks in Lovech follow Eastern European Time during the standard-time part of the year. EET corresponds to UTC+2, meaning that local civil time is two hours ahead of Coordinated Universal Time.
When daylight saving applies, Lovech observes Eastern European Summer Time. EEST corresponds to UTC+3. The switch is made under the same national arrangement followed elsewhere in Bulgaria, rather than by a separate regional decision.
This distinction matters when converting a future appointment. Using the label “Lovech time” alone may be insufficient unless the date is known, because the UTC offset depends on whether standard time or summer time is then in effect.

Places across Lovech Region
Lovech Region lies in north-central Bulgaria and takes its name from its administrative capital, Lovech. The territory extends from areas near the Danubian Plain toward the Balkan Mountains, giving it varied landscapes and local horizons.
Its notable towns include: Lovech, the regional seat on the Osam River Troyan, a town close to the northern slopes of the Balkan Mountains Teteven, situated among mountain surroundings Lukovit, in the region’s northern part
Yablanitsa, near routes crossing this part of Bulgaria Letnitsa and Ugarchin, two other municipal centres The clocks in these places agree. Their daylight experience can nevertheless feel different because a mountain town, a river valley, and a more open northern location do not share the same visible horizon.
Reading the sunrise time
The sunrise value for Lovech refers to a particular date and location. It changes gradually from one day to the next as Earth’s position relative to the Sun alters the length of daylight. It should be checked again when planning for another day.
A calculated sunrise normally describes an astronomical event at the horizon. Buildings, hills, trees, and mountain ridges may delay the moment when the Sun itself becomes visible from a specific street or viewpoint. Dawn also begins before sunrise, so usable natural light can arrive earlier than the listed event.
Travellers heading toward Troyan or Teteven should use a forecast or astronomical listing for the nearest town. The difference may be modest, but local terrain is relevant when timing a walk, photograph, or early departure.
Questions and answers
- Does Lovech have a separate regional time?
- No. Lovech follows the same official time as the rest of Bulgaria.
- What do EET and EEST mean?
- EET is Eastern European Time at UTC+2. EEST is the daylight-saving clock at UTC+3.
- Is dawn the same as sunrise?
- No. Dawn is the period of increasing light before the Sun reaches the horizon; sunrise is the specified solar event.
